So what really is the free flow of information? Well there was an rule that was put out called the "Free Flow of Information Act" which pretty much protects reporters, journalists, and news article reporters from being forced to have to reveal their sources to their information on the take they currently have going on or have already published when faced of federal prosecution. Although this law sounds promising everywhere, it has not been mandated nationally yet. This act pretty much began due to the White House pushing for federal protection when it came to media.
